Hastings Cemetery in Sussex, United Kingdom, is a peaceful site that commemorates the contributions of World War 1 soldiers. One Australian Fromelles soldier is honored here. The cemetery stands as a testament to the sacrifices made by soldiers during the war. It also includes a section for the graves of the town's mayors and other dignitaries. There are 92 soldiers buried in this cemetery.
